# California AB 791 (20112012) — Dependent children: birth certificates.
|
||
|
||
Existing law provides for the removal of a child from the custody of a parent or guardian on the basis of abuse or neglect, as specified. Existing law requires the juvenile court to order the social worker to provide family reunification services, unless specified conditions exist. Existing law requires the court to order that reunification services be terminated if it decides to permanently terminate parental rights with regard to, or establish legal guardianship of, the child.

## Timeline
|
||
|
||
The legislative action history — every referral, reading, and vote.
|
||
|
||
- **2011-02-17** Read first time. To print. `reading-1`
|
||
- **2011-02-18** From printer. May be heard in committee March 20.
|
||
- **2011-03-10** Referred to Com. on JUD. `referral-committee`
|
||
- **2011-03-30** From committee chair, with author's amendments: Amend, and re-refer to Com. on JUD. Read second time and amended. `reading-2, amendment-introduction, reading-1, amendment-passage`
|
||
- **2011-03-31** Re-referred to Com. on JUD. `referral-committee`
|
||
- **2011-04-05** From committee: Do pass. (Ayes 10. Noes 0.) (April 5). `committee-passage, committee-passage-favorable`
|
||
- **2011-04-06** Read second time. Ordered to third reading. `reading-2, reading-1`
|
||
- **2011-04-28** Read third time. Passed. Ordered to the Senate. (Ayes 77. Noes 0. Page 1124.) `reading-3, reading-1, passage`
|
||
- **2011-04-28** In Senate. Read first time. To Com. on RLS. for assignment. `reading-1`
|
||
- **2011-05-12** Referred to Com. on JUD. `referral-committee`
|
||
- **2011-06-07** From committee: Do pass. To consent calendar. (Ayes 5. Noes 0.) (June 7). `committee-passage, committee-passage-favorable`
|
||
- **2011-06-08** Read second time. Ordered to consent calendar. `reading-2, reading-1`
|
||
- **2011-06-10** Read third time. Passed. Ordered to the Assembly. (Ayes 39. Noes 0. Page 1377.). `reading-3, reading-1, passage`
|
||
- **2011-06-13** In Assembly. Ordered to Engrossing and Enrolling. `committee-passage`
|
||
- **2011-06-21** Enrolled and presented to the Governor at 11:40 a.m.
|
||
- **2011-06-30** Approved by the Governor. `executive-signature`
|
||
- **2011-07-01** Chaptered by Secretary of State - Chapter 59, Statutes of 2011.
